How the formula works

Both dram per cubic centimeter and imperial hundredweight per fluid ounce measure the same physical quantity (mass per unit volume), so converting between them is a single multiplication. Multiply a value in dram per cubic centimeter by 0.001031 to get imperial hundredweight per fluid ounce. To reverse the conversion, multiply a imperial hundredweight per fluid ounce value by 969.515659 to get back to dram per cubic centimeter.
